China's first cargo ship Tianzhou-1 to be launched in 2017
The Tianzhou-1, which literally means "heavenly vessel," will be able to send 5 tons of cargo into space. It is designed to provide supplies for China's future orbiting space station.

Who is responsible for 'human-eating' dry wells in N China?
A boy's death has sparked an outcry across the country, but local departments of water resources, agriculture, and urban-rural development all said that the wells are not in their domain.
